From 1ed27b1befdb4b61a0ec7764febafb22c382c520 Mon Sep 17 00:00:00 2001 From: Vlastimil Holer Date: Tue, 28 Nov 2017 11:55:58 +0100 Subject: [PATCH] Add 30 seconds timeout on EC2 user data fetch Closes #62 --- src/usr/sbin/one-contextd |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/usr/sbin/one-contextd b/src/usr/sbin/one-contextd index 6c27c66..67bd18c 100755 --- a/src/usr/sbin/one-contextd +++ b/src/usr/sbin/one-contextd @@ -164,7 +164,7 @@ function get_new_context { vmtoolsd --cmd 'info-get guestinfo.opennebula.context' | \ openssl base64 -d > ${CONTEXT_NEW} - elif curl -s -o ${CONTEXT_NEW} http://169.254.169.254/latest/user-data; then + elif curl -s -m 30 -o ${CONTEXT_NEW} http://169.254.169.254/latest/user-data; then log debug "Reading EC2 user-data" echo -n "" fi